There is no better or more economical way to keep rabbits out of the garden than good chicken wire, or wire mesh perimeter fence, bottom bent outward and sunk to a depth of at least 6″ … WebMar 15, 2024 · Adding chicken wire to your fence can deter rabbits from entering your garden. Attach the chicken wire to the rails using zip ties or staples, ensuring it is at least 3 feet tall and buried 6 inches deep. By creating physical barriers around your garden, you can prevent rabbits from accessing your plants and causing damage. Whether it smells, a fence, or even adding a new furry friend … WebJul 7, 2024 · An alternative to installing a fence around your entire yard is to fence off just those areas, such as the vegetable garden, where rabbits can do the most damage. Choose fence material with a mesh of one inch or less and, if possible, bury the bottom of the fence a few inches into the ground. Make sure the fence is tall enough too, at least ...

Last winter, we saw a lot of damage to trees and shrubs from rabbits. If you see damage circling the entire trunk, this will most likely result in death or serious injury to the plant.
